The Role

The Operations Manager keeps the Academy running so teachers can teach. Reporting to the Director of Business, you’ll manage the physical and operational life of the school — facilities, safety, transportation, food service, and vendor relationships — and supervise custodial, maintenance, and operational support staff.

This is a hands-on, execution-oriented role for someone who thrives on making complex organizations work quietly and well.

What You’ll Do

  • Oversee maintenance, repairs, and cleanliness of all buildings and grounds
  • Manage safety protocols, emergency drills, and security systems; serve as primary liaison with local law enforcement and emergency services
  • Ensure compliance with health, safety, fire, and regulatory requirements — and keep the documentation to prove it
  • Oversee student transportation systems, vehicle compliance, and vendor performance
  • Manage cafeteria operations and the third-party food service provider
  • Coordinate operational technology needs (cameras, access control, phones, printers) with the IT department
  • Manage vendor contracts and service relationships across all operational areas

What You Bring

  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ience
  • 5–8 years of progressive operations, facilities, or property management experience with supervisory responsibility
  • Demonstrated skill managing regulatory compliance, inspections, and documentation
  • Strong organizational and communication skills; comfortable working across departments
  • Calm under pressure, detail-oriented, and genuinely execution-focused

Bonus: Prior experience in a school, university, or institutional setting; familiarity with school transportation or food service regulations; OSHA, facilities, or project management certifications.

Lower School Learning Specialist

Position Summary

Providence Academy seeks an experienced and faith-filled Learning Specialist to join our Lower School faculty.  The Learning Specialist role is to ensure that students with specialized learning needs make successful academic progress in the Lower School and gain lifelong learning tools while embracing the school’s mission. The role involves conducting regular reading and math screenings; reviewing educational evaluations and implementing recommendations; setting goals; creating and communicating classroom accommodations; collaborating with teachers; and providing regular updates to teachers, students, and their parents on academic progress. The role also includes coaching students in applying organizational, reading, math, and study strategies to help them achieve academic proficiency.

Key Responsibilities

Academic Support and Assessments

  • Be knowledgeable of various best practices in teaching students with learning diagnoses (familiarity with the DSM-V).
  • Coordinate regular reading and math assessments of all LS students, including interpreting results and offering support to students below grade level
  • Create and manage student accommodation plans to address unique learning challenges.
  • Track student progress and achievement with student accommodation plans in coordination with the Lower School student support team
  • Coordinate and manage files and/or paperwork in relation to students with learning needs.

Instructional Coordination Responsibilities

  • Meet with students individually or in a small group as needed for academic support in phonics, reading, math, and/or study skill enhancement.
  • Interface with counselors, teachers, parents, administrators, and medical professionals, and school district special education personnel related to diagnoses and interventions for learning differences.
  • Communicate suggested study methods for parents to utilize at home to enhance skills and support their students’ academic success.
  • Collaborate with other learning support personnel across the school divisions to ensure a continuum of academic support for students with learning needs.

Qualifications

  • A bachelor’s degree or higher with a strong knowledge base in identifying and accommodating learning differences. 
  • Reading specialist endorsement or specialized training in this area.
  • Ideal candidates will have at least three to five years of teaching experience, an understanding of differentiated instruction, a flexible and team-oriented approach, excellent written and oral communication skills, exceptional organizational skills and attention to detail, and superior interpersonal skills.
